Real Madrid's Fine and Its Impact on Betting Trends

Real Madrid's recent fine and stadium closure could influence betting dynamics in upcoming matches.

<p>Real Madrid has been fined €15,000 and faces a suspended partial stadium closure due to the behavior of a supporter who performed a Nazi salute prior to their Champions League match against Benfica. This incident occurred during a week where Madrid secured a 2-1 victory at the Santiago Bernabeu, completing a 3-1 aggregate win that advanced them to the round of 16 against Manchester City. The club has expressed its condemnation of such gestures, emphasizing their commitment to promoting a safe and respectful sporting environment.</p><p>The suspended partial stadium closure affects 500 seats in the lower south stand for one UEFA club fixture, but it remains suspended for one year.
